Define the Prototyping Model
In this model, a working model of actual software is developed originally. Prototype is just like a sample software having low reliability and lesser functional capabilities and it doesn't undergo through the rigorous testing phase. Developing a working prototype in first phase overcomes the drawback of the waterfall model where reporting about serious errors is possible only after completion of software development.
Working prototype is given to customer for operation. Customer, afterits use, gives feedback. Analysing the feedback given bythe customer, developer refines, adds requirements and prepares final specification document. Once prototype becomes operational, actual product is developed using normal waterfall model.
